Overview

The Segger 8.06.19 is a passive adapter board designed to convert the standard J-Link 20-pin 0.1-inch header to a 14-pin 2.0mm pitch JTAG header. This adapter specifically facilitates connection to target boards utilizing the Xilinx-style JTAG pinout. It ensures reliable signal integrity for debugging and programming without requiring custom cabling.

Getting Started

Connect the 20-pin female side of the adapter directly to the J-Link ribbon cable and plug the 14-pin 2.0mm male connector into the target board. Ensure the J-Link software is configured for JTAG mode to match the interface supported by this adapter.
